# Legacy Pricing Adjustment (Managers Only)

Quillhaven Systems will increase legacy-tier pricing by 7% from 1 April, affecting roughly 2,300 accounts on retired Lantern plans. Customer notices follow a sixty-day schedule, with hardship deferrals available case by case. Revenue impact and churn projections were reviewed by the board's pricing committee. The underlying strategic reasoning appears in the confidential note below.

internal memo for kawip-hadug: Headcount on the Wenwyn team goes from 7 to 140 by the end of January. Gross margin on Wenwyn came in at 20 percent against a plan of 15 percent.

MEMO — Sales Leads Only

Pilot churn on the Quellix Desk programme hit 18% last month. Three of the Brantvale accounts cancelled before week six; exit surveys cite onboarding friction, not price. Fix: assign a named contact to every pilot account by Friday. Renewal calls start Monday. No extensions without my sign-off. Deck follows from Marta Oelsen's team. The next phase hinges on what follows below.

confidential, hahig-hawip: The renewal with Holixix Holdings closes at $10 million a year, 15 percent above the last contract. Project Ulawyn slips by a full year because of the tooling delay.

- [ ] Step 7: Archive cold storage buckets (Glacierline tier). Confirm both ceremony witnesses are present, verify bucket manifests match the Oxbow ledger, then seal the archive key shares. Plugin authors may observe but not handle shares. Once sealed, the archive index itself is encrypted and can only be reopened with the passphrase below.

vault phrase of badup-hahig = tamael-aldael-kelmir-istael-fenok-istwyn-tamius-jorath-oliion

**Ticket: Duplicate events after calendar sync conflict**

Welcome aboard — this one's a good starter. When the Merrowday client syncs against the Plimstone scheduling service, a conflict on a recurring event creates duplicates instead of merging. Repro: edit the same occurrence on two devices while offline, then reconnect. Expected: conflict dialog. Actual: both versions persist. Check the merge resolver in the sync module first. The affected build's token is below.

pipeline stamp: htk31_f769b577b3028a4e9958e5bb8d1259a